Recap: Newton Eagles vs. Mattoon Greenwave
Newton put another one in the bag on Tuesday to keep their perfect season alive. They never let the Mattoon Greenwave onto the board and left with a 10-0 victory. Newton's pitching crew has been rock solid lately; the team hasn't given up a run in their last four games.
Lexie Grove was a standout: she scored two runs and stole a base while going 3-for-3. The team also got some help courtesy of Bailee Frichtl, who scored three runs and stole a base while going 3-for-3.
Newton pushed their record up to 5-0 with that win, which was their fourth straight at home.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Newton will challenge Pana at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day. As for Mattoon, they will head out on the road to square off against Sullivan at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. Mattoon will come in still looking for their first win of the season.
